Solution Overview
Problem
Standard horizontal paint roller trays lack stability when used on ladders, have limited paint capacity, and are not portable, making them inconvenient for painters.
Innovation Solution
A portable paint and tool container with a versatile handle, detachable shoulder strap, and a rear flange for tool storage, allowing secure hanging on ladders and stable use on horizontal surfaces, featuring a magnetic paint brush holder, replaceable liner, and a paint-spreading screen for efficient paint application.
Engineering Contradictions & Design Principles
Engineering Contradiction Analysis
1Ease of operation
If a standard horizontal roller tray is used, then paint distribution is achieved, but stability when used on a ladder deteriorates
Solution Approach 1:
The patent transitions from a horizontal tray design to a vertical container design, fundamentally changing the orientation dimension. The container hangs vertically on the ladder, with the paint distribution surface oriented vertically, allowing the painter to roll paint upward rather than forward, thereby achieving both stability on the ladder and effective paint distribution.
Solution Approach 2:
The patent introduces a ladder-mounted holder or hook as an intermediary device that secures the container to the ladder structure. This intermediary component provides the stability connection between the container and ladder, freeing the painter's hands while maintaining secure positioning and stable paint distribution capability.
2Ease of operation
If a standard horizontal roller tray is used, then paint distribution is achieved, but portability deteriorates
Solution Approach 1:
The patent employs a dynamic, multi-position handle system that can be rotated and positioned in various orientations. The handle can be adjusted to different angles and positions, allowing the container to be comfortably carried by hand, hung on the ladder, or held in various ergonomic positions, thereby achieving superior portability and adaptability.
Solution Approach 2:
The container is designed with multiple functional capabilities: it can hang vertically on ladders, be carried by hand with an adjustable handle, and potentially be positioned in various orientations. This multi-functionality makes the device adaptable to different working conditions and painter preferences, greatly enhancing portability.
3Device complexity
If a standard horizontal roller tray is used, then simple structure is maintained, but paint capacity deteriorates
Solution Approach 1:
The patent incorporates a removable paint screen or distributor insert within the container, creating a nested structure. The screen can be inserted into the container body, providing an additional functional element without significantly increasing overall complexity. This nested design allows for increased paint capacity while maintaining relatively simple construction.
